0 Comments Published February 15th, 2009 in Piedmont, Montclair, Rockridge, Crocker Highlands/Lakeshore, Foreclosure/REO, Short Sale. by Julie Joyce, Coldwell BankerChart below is the companion to my previous post which differentiates Average Sale Price for REO (Foreclosures), Short Sales & Non-distress (Conventional) homes. The trend is what would be expected, except in Piedmont. It seems the higher Avg Price per Sq Ft in Piedmont for REO’s is probably because one of the (only) two Foreclosures in Piedmont was <1400 sq ft. Square Footage numbers always skew high for small homes.
Foreclosure, Short Sale, “Non-distress” Average Price Comparison in Oakland & Piedmont
1 Comment Published February 13th, 2009 in Piedmont, Montclair, Rockridge, Crocker Highlands/Lakeshore, Foreclosure/REO, Short Sale. by Julie Joyce, Coldwell BankerThe Chart above shows the disparity of Average Home Sale Price by isolating the data based on whether the home was in Foreclosure (REO), a Short Sale, or a “Conventional” Sale….my term for all homes sold that were “Non-Distressed” Sales. Data is derived from local MLS which did not differentiate prior to June 2008 so the numbers above include all homes sold from July 1 2008-Feb 12, 2009.
Note: In Montclair one of the 7 Short Sales sold for $2,250,000 which skews the numbers a bit.
